Schools in Kashmir to reopen July 27

Summer vacation extended amid continuing severe weather, safety concerns

Kashmir Impulse Desk

Srinagar, July 21

The J&K government has extended the summer vacation for all government and recognised private schools in Kashmir Division and the winter zones of Jammu Division until July 26, with classes scheduled to resume on July 27.

School Education Minister Sakeena Itoo said the decision was taken in view of the safety and well-being of students, teachers and their families.

She urged residents to remain vigilant and follow advisories issued by the authorities as heavy rainfall continued to affect parts of J&K.
